how to distinguish between session cookies and persistent
cookies while doing cookies testing??
Answer / sushma
Session cookies - these are temporary and are erased when
you close your browser at the end of your surfing session.
The next time you visit that particular site it will not
recognise you and will treat you as a completely new visitor
as there is nothing in your browser to let the site know
that you have visited before (more on session cookies).
Persistent cookies - these remain on your hard drive until
you erase them or they expire. How long a cookie remains on
your browser depends on how long the visited website has
programmed the cookie to last (more on persistent cookies).
